TIPE
DATA
A.
Variabel
Variabel merupakan container yang digunakan untuk menyimpan
suatu nilai pada sebuah program dengan tipe data tertentu. Bahasa C# mengenal dua
tipe variabel data, yaitu:
·
Tipeprimitif
Tipe primitive merupakan tipe dasar yang disediakan oleh bahasa
pemrograman C# untuk nilai tertentu.Tipe primitive meliputi :
Tipe referens imerupakan tipe yang dikembangkan dari tipe
dasar dengan tujuan memenuhi kebutuhan tipe data kompleks dengan mereferensi kesebuah
nilai.Tipe referensi meliputi:
a.
Array
b.
Class
c.
Interface
d.
Delegate
Dibawah ini adalah Tabel perbedaan antara tipe primitive dan
tipe referensi:
B. Tipe
data Variabel
Ada beberapa aturan yang harus kita perhatikan dalam memberikan
nama sebuah variable karena sangat berpengaruh dalam program yang akan dibangun,
kalau kita salah memberkan nama variabel, maka program kita pasti akan error.
Pemberian nama variable dalam Bahasa pemrograman C# harus
mengikuti aturan dibawah ini :
¨
Variabelharusterdiridarisederetankarakterunicode
yang diawali oleh karakter huruf atau under score (_)
¨
Variabel
tidak boleh berupa keyword, kecuali diawali @.
¨
C#
Merupakan bahasa pemrograman bersifat case sesitif (artinya huruf Kapital dan huruf
kecil dianggap berbeda) misalnya nama dan NAMA dianggap berbeda.
¨
Variabel
harus unik dalam suatu scope
C. Tipe
Data Boolean
Dalam pemrograman C#, tipe data Boolean akan memiliki dua
nilai, yaitu nilai true mewakili nilai benar sedangkan nilai false mewakili nilai
salah. Tipe data Boolean dalam bahasa C# dikenal keyword bool.
Contoh :
Berikut adalah contoh pemrograman dari tipe data
Output :
OPERATOR
Dalam membangun ekspresi program, kita pasti membutuhkan
operator. Bahasa pemrograman C# memiliki berbagai operator, di antaranya :
·
Operator Aritmatika
Sama halnya dengan bahasa pemrograman lain, C# menyediakan
operator-operator aritmatika untuk manipulasi dan mengelola variable data numerik.
Berikutnya, kita dapat melihat daftar operator aritmatika.
Tabel Operator aritmatika
·
Operator relasional
Sama halnya dengan bahasa pemrograman java dan C++, C#
menyediakan operator relasional untuk memani pulasi perbandingan antara dua nilai
sehingga menghasilkan nilai bool. Dibawah kita dapat melihat daftar operator
relasional.
Tabel Operator relasional
Contoh :
1.
Buatlah
program dari operator aritmatika dimana terdapat penambahan, pengurangan,
perkalian, pembagian dan modulus
Output :
2.
Buatlah
program menghitung luas segitiga
Output :
0 komentar:
Posting Komentar